Study and Design for Electric Control Gas Injection LPG Engine

By using liquefied petroleum gas (LPG) as alternative fuel,the Passat 2.0 vehicle was transformed into a LPG single-fuel vehicle.The improved plan for the electric control gas injection system was established.Taking Nikki supply fuel system as a LPG electric control injection system,the target of the economy,power and emission index was set out so as to reach the optimization control of the whole engine. The practice and applied performance of LPG engine was studied.The engine tests and whole vehicle tests show that the Passat 2.0 LPG vehicle after matching can achieve low emission in terms of CO and NO_x emis- sion,and the exhaust level conformed to EURO-Ⅲexhaust standard,the maximum average speed of LPG vehicle can reach 180 km/h,the tests also find that when using LPG,the maximum torque characteristics moves to the low speed field and power characteristics is a little inferior to the original.
